Designed for developers who use Windows 10/11 with WSL2, and have large WSL2 volumes that need cleaning and compacting. Can often save 10-100+ GB of space on your SSD.
One-click "Clean & Compact" that runs all enabled cleanup tasks, runs filesystem TRIM, and compacts your virtual disk automatically. Shows step-by-step progress with a live timer and before/after disk size comparison. Failed steps show expandable error details so you can see exactly what went wrong. Celebration effects play when space is saved (confetti for 1 GB+).
You can also run "Clean only" mode (without compaction) for a faster pass that skips the WSL shutdown/restart cycle.
Full control over every cleanup task. Each task has a toggle, a description explaining exactly what it does, and shows estimated reclaimable space. Tasks are organized into collapsible categories and can be searched with the filter bar.

Enable or disable automatic VHDX compaction after cleanup. When enabled, the cleaner will shut down WSL, update it, compact all virtual disks using Optimize-VHD (with automatic UAC elevation), and restart your distros. When disabled, the cleaner runs cleanup tasks only -- faster, with no WSL restart required.

Benchmark WSL startup time and profile shell configuration to identify performance bottlenecks.
- Boot time benchmarker -- cold-boots each distro and measures startup time with
process.hrtimeprecision - Historical tracking -- saves benchmark results and displays a Chart.js trend line across runs
- Shell startup profiler -- detects your shell (bash/zsh/fish), measures total vs baseline (no-rc) startup time, and reports the RC file overhead
- Per-file analysis -- individually times sourcing of each config file (~/.bashrc, ~/.zshrc, etc.) with line counts
- Slow item detection -- scans RC files for known bottlenecks: nvm, conda, oh-my-zsh, pyenv, rbenv, sdkman, homebrew, compinit, antigen
- Actionable suggestions -- each detected item includes a specific fix recommendation
GUI editor for .wslconfig (global) and per-distro wsl.conf files with validated fields and smart defaults.
.wslconfig tab -- global WSL 2 settings applied to all distros:
- Memory limit, processor count, swap size, swap file path
- Networking mode (NAT / Mirrored), localhost forwarding, DNS tunneling, DNS proxy, auto proxy, firewall
- Auto memory reclaim (disabled / gradual / drop cache), sparse VHD, page reporting
- Nested virtualization, VM idle timeout, GUI applications (WSLg), debug console, kernel command line
wsl.conf tab -- per-distro settings with distro selector:
- Automount -- enable/disable Windows drive mounting, mount root, DrvFs options, fstab processing
- Interop -- Windows executable interop, Windows PATH appending
- User -- default login username
- Boot -- systemd toggle, boot command
- Network -- custom hostname, /etc/hosts generation, resolv.conf generation
Optimize buttons -- auto-fill recommended values based on your system hardware:
- Allocates 50% of host RAM and 50% of CPU cores to WSL
- Enables mirrored networking, DNS tunneling, gradual memory reclaim, sparse VHD, and other sensible defaults
- Per-distro optimization enables systemd, standard automount, and Windows interop
Safety features:
- Automatic backup (
.wslconfig.bak/wsl.conf.bak) before every save - Field validation (memory format, processor range, timeout values)
- Restart banner with one-click "Restart WSL" after saving changes

A standalone command-line interface for scripting and automation:
node cli.js [options]
Options:
--list Show available WSL distros
--clean Run cleanup tasks
--compact Compact VHDX files
--list-tasks Show all 60+ task IDs
--distro, -d <name> Target distribution
--tasks, -t <ids> Comma-separated task IDs
--exclude <ids> Skip specific tasks
--dry-run Preview without executing
--json Machine-readable output
--no-aggressive Skip destructive tasks
--verbose, -v Detailed output
--quiet, -q Suppress output
--help, -h Usage info
--version Show version
